Commit 7c0c47b7 authored by Cresson Remi's avatar Cresson Remi
Browse files

ADD: build all docker images

2 merge requests!39Release 3.2,!26TFRecord, to_tfrecords(), refac python modules, new CI
Pipeline #35898 passed with stages
in 95 minutes and 25 seconds
Showing with 16 additions and 2 deletions
+16 -2
...@@ -63,6 +63,7 @@ docker image: ...@@ -63,6 +63,7 @@ docker image:
--cache-from $CACHE_IMAGE_BASE --cache-from $CACHE_IMAGE_BASE
--cache-from $CACHE_IMAGE_BUILDER --cache-from $CACHE_IMAGE_BUILDER
--cache-from $CI_REGISTRY_IMAGE:$CI_COMMIT_REF_NAME --cache-from $CI_REGISTRY_IMAGE:$CI_COMMIT_REF_NAME
--cache-from $CI_REGISTRY_IMAGE:cpu-basic-dev-testing
--tag $CI_REGISTRY_IMAGE:$CI_COMMIT_REF_NAME --tag $CI_REGISTRY_IMAGE:$CI_COMMIT_REF_NAME
--build-arg OTBTESTS="true" --build-arg OTBTESTS="true"
--build-arg KEEP_SRC_OTB="true" --build-arg KEEP_SRC_OTB="true"
...@@ -153,5 +154,18 @@ deploy: ...@@ -153,5 +154,18 @@ deploy:
script: script:
- echo "Shippping!" - echo "Shippping!"
- docker pull $CI_REGISTRY_IMAGE:$CI_COMMIT_REF_NAME - docker pull $CI_REGISTRY_IMAGE:$CI_COMMIT_REF_NAME
- docker tag $CI_REGISTRY_IMAGE:$CI_COMMIT_REF_NAME $CI_REGISTRY_IMAGE:cpu-basic-test - docker tag $CI_REGISTRY_IMAGE:$CI_COMMIT_REF_NAME $CI_REGISTRY_IMAGE:cpu-basic-dev-testing
- docker push $CI_REGISTRY_IMAGE:cpu-basic-test - docker push $CI_REGISTRY_IMAGE:cpu-basic-dev-testing
- docker build --network='host' --tag $CI_REGISTRY_IMAGE:cpu-basic --build-arg BASE_IMG=ubuntu:20.04 --build-arg BZL_CONFIGS="" . # cpu-basic
- docker push $CI_REGISTRY_IMAGE:cpu-basic
- docker build --network='host' --tag $CI_REGISTRY_IMAGE:cpu-basic-dev --build-arg BASE_IMG=ubuntu:20.04 --build-arg BZL_CONFIGS="" --build-arg KEEP_SRC_OTB=true . # cpu-basic-dev
- docker push $CI_REGISTRY_IMAGE:cpu-basic-dev
- docker build --network='host' --tag $CI_REGISTRY_IMAGE:gpu --build-arg BASE_IMG=nvidia/cuda:11.2.2-cudnn8-devel-ubuntu20.04 . # gpu
- docker push $CI_REGISTRY_IMAGE:gpu
- docker build --network='host' --tag mdl4eo/otbtf${VER}:gpu-dev --build-arg BASE_IMG=nvidia/cuda:11.2.2-cudnn8-devel-ubuntu20.04 --build-arg KEEP_SRC_OTB=true . # gpu-dev
- docker push $CI_REGISTRY_IMAGE:gpu-dev
- docker build --network='host' --tag $CI_REGISTRY_IMAGE:gpu-basic --build-arg BASE_IMG=nvidia/cuda:11.2.2-cudnn8-devel-ubuntu20.04 --build-arg BZL_CONFIGS="" . # gpu-basic
- docker push $CI_REGISTRY_IMAGE:gpu-basic
- docker build --network='host' --tag mdl4eo/otbtf${VER}:gpu-basic-dev --build-arg BZL_CONFIGS="" --build-arg BASE_IMG=nvidia/cuda:11.2.2-cudnn8-devel-ubuntu20.04 --build-arg KEEP_SRC_OTB=true . # gpu-basic-dev
- docker push $CI_REGISTRY_IMAGE:gpu-basic-dev
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ment